One of probably the most awe-inspiring sights in Western Australia, Lake Hillier is located 11km from Cape Arid National Park and is separated from the ocean by a strip of sand. Being so close to the ocean, it has a excessive degree of salinity, and this is what gives the waters their bright pink appearance. They are the rarest of the massive whales and grow as a lot as 17.5m long. They are straightforward to identify as, unlike most whales, they don’t have a dorsal fin. They move slowly, have large callosities (horny growths) on their giant heads, and are commonly seen near shore, often wanting like a floating log. They had been so named as a end result of they were the “right” whale to harpoon.

Opened in 2014, the award-winning National Anzac Centre is an interactive method to learn a little more about our State’s wealthy historical past and affiliation with the ANZACs. In a uniquely immersive means, guests can comply with the private stories of ANZAC-related figures who departed from the Port of Albany through interactive media, artefacts, film, images and audio. At the tip of the museum walk-through, guests have the chance to pay respects on an interactive tribute wall. Perth and the Margaret River region have a Mediterranean local weather with hot, dry summers and funky, wet winters. February is the most popular month of the 12 months, with a median high of 31.6 degrees Celsius, while July is the coldest month with a median low of seven.9 degrees Celsius.

Then continue on to admire the tallest lighthouse on mainland Australia, Cape Leeuwin Lighthouse. This historic lighthouse is located at the tip of a spectacular peninsula, where the Southern and Indian Oceans meet at the most south-westerly point of Australia.

These squid are predators in their very own proper and might grow up to 13 meters in length. The battle for all times is on display each second in the Bremer Canyons. Every inhabitants of Orca have a selected food regimen and our analysis signifies that the Orca of Bremer Bay get pleasure from foraging on Squid, Beaked Whale and Tuna when out there. Other species of baleen whale have additionally been targeted and our onboard analysis has documented Blue Whales, Humpback Whales and Antarctic Minke Whales being included in the food plan of the Bremer Bay Orca. A true apex predator, Orca stay in matrilineal pods with the elder females leading the family. The Orca of Bremer Bay live in household pods of 6-20 individuals and through each journey we are going to introduce you to the households we meet.

On day 5, drive to Pemberton through Nannup and Manjimup; home to the Périgord truffle. Known as Australia’s truffle heartland, Manjimup has some of the most nutrient-rich soils excellent for growing truffles. In winter, join a truffle dog hunt to seek for this black gold and indulge on truffles at one of the area’s eating places. Feast on other native delights corresponding to marron, trout, cherries and chestnuts alongside the method in which.
